  5. So I am actually going to one of my first big con this year when I go to New York Comic Con. Never really gone to one that big before. I can’t wait. I think it will be a blast. Have you guys gone to that one? If so did you enjoy it?

    1. We have gone to the NYCC once and it was a fun time. There are TONS of people tho when it gets later in the day so my big advice is get there early and wait in the line to get in, its worth it. Do your shopping around on the floor early in the day. I remember wanting to look at stuff at tables and booths in the afternoon and I couldn’t get near them. But the mornings are nice. They also have a big celebrity section and its in a totally different area which is really nice. It’s a lot of fun, hope you have a good time.

      1. Thanks. I do hope to get some signatures and pictures with celebs but my major focus is just finding cool stuff and seeing some panels.

        1. Hope you enjoy it. NYCC was fun, does get a tad bit insane but not as bad as San Diego. If you want to meet up with some of the celebs I’d advise knocking those out in one day. A lot of them have assigned times if you want to get things like photos.
